How Our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Service Actually Works
Our team follows a strict process to ensure your bathroom is restored to its original condition. We start by assessing the damage, identifying the source of the leak, and containing the affected area to prevent further damage. Next, we use specialized equipment to extract water and dry the area, followed by a thorough cleaning and disinfection. Finally, we work with you to restore your bathroom to its original state, including any necessary repairs or replacements. A proper process matters don’t let corners be cut on your restoration job.

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Cost in Kensington, MD
The cost of bathroom water damage restoration in Kensington, MD can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on average costs and may not reflect your specific situation. Contact us today for a free estimate and to schedule your service.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and removal |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of the damage, size of the affected area |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of the damage, size of the aff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Cleaning and disinfection |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of the damage, size of the affected area, type of cleaning solutions needed |
| Restoration and rep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Severity of the damage, size of the affected area, type of repairs needed |
| Containment and assessment |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of the damage, size of the affected area, complexity of the job |
